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to a building’s foundation to create a protective barrier. This process helps prevent the infiltration of moisture, water, and other environmental elements that can compromise the integrity of the foundation. The sealing materials used are typically designed to withstand soil pressure, temperature fluctuations, and exposure to water, ensuring the foundation remains durable and stable over time. Proper sealing can also enhance the foundation’s resistance to cracking and deterioration caused by moisture-related issues.

One of the primary problems that foundation sealing addresses is water intrusion, which can lead to significant structural damage if left unchecked. Excess moisture can cause the concrete to weaken, develop cracks, or develop mold and mildew problems in the surrounding areas. Sealing services help mitigate these risks by creating a barrier that reduces water seepage and minimizes the potential for erosion or soil movement around the foundation. Additionally, sealing can help prevent issues such as basement flooding, efflorescence, and foundation settling, all of which can be costly to repair and disruptive to property stability.

Properties that typically utilize foundation sealing services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and industrial facilities. Homes in areas with high water tables, frequent rainfall, or fluctuating soil moisture levels are more likely to require sealing to protect against water damage. Commercial properties, such as warehouses, retail stores, and office buildings, also benefit from foundation sealing to maintain structural integrity and prevent moisture-related issues that could disrupt operations or cause long-term damage.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richfield,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Preparation Costs - The cost for sealing concrete foundations typically ranges from $300 to $700, depending on the size and condition of the surface. Larger or more complex projects may cost more, with some estimates reaching up to $1,000. Local pros can provide detailed quotes based on specific needs.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for foundation sealing services generally fall between $1.50 and $3.00 per square foot. For an average-sized foundation, total labor costs might range from $500 to $2,000. Prices vary based on project complexity and local market rates.

Type of Sealant and Materials - The choice of sealant impacts overall costs, with basic waterproofing coatings costing around $1.00 to $2.50 per square foot. More advanced or specialized sealants can increase the price, potentially adding several hundred dollars to the project. Local contractors can recommend suitable options.

Additional Service Fees - Extra services such as surface cleaning, crack repair, or surface preparation can add $200 to $600 to the total cost. Costs vary based on the extent of prep work needed and the specific services requested by homeowners or property managers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ture exposure.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help prevent water leaks, reduce cracking, and extend the lifespan of a foundation by protecting it from moisture-related issues.

How often should foundation sealing be performed? The frequency of sealing depends on the type of sealant used and local conditions, but generally, reapplication every few years is recommended.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include epoxy, polyurethane, and asphalt-based coatings, each suited for different conditions and preferences.
